Reijo Rantanen’s degree programme at Tampere University of Technology was automation engineering. He specialized in control engineering, signal processing and computer technology. He has also taken basic courses on mechanical engineering.

After graduation, Reijo worked for five years as a researcher and project manager for a research unit of an international electric power and automation technology company.

In 1999, he started as a patent attorney at Kolster and has since drafted numerous patent applications for various application fields of automation, electrical and mechanical engineering, as well as attended to related opposition and appeal proceedings. Reijo is also well versed in infringement opinions and novelty searches.

The fields of technology familiar to Reijo include, in particular, paper machine automation, methods and apparatuses for pulp processing, control engineering, measuring techniques, various automation devices and systems, rock drilling equipment, hoisting apparatuses, transport engineering, and fault diagnostics for power supply systems.
